/**
* Convert the following characters that must be recognized as label
* separators per RFC 3490 to ASCII full stop characters
*
* U+3002 (ideographic full stop)
* U+FF0E (fullwidth full stop)
* U+FF61 (halfwidth ideographic full stop)
*/
void normalizeFullStops(nsAString& s);

/**
* Determine whether a label is considered safe to display to the user
* according to the algorithm defined in UTR 39 and the profile
* selected in mRestrictionProfile.
*
* For the ASCII-only profile, returns false for all labels containing
* non-ASCII characters.
*
* For the other profiles, returns false for labels containing any of
* the following:
*
* Characters in scripts other than the "recommended scripts" and
* "aspirational scripts" defined in
* http://www.unicode.org/reports/tr31/#Table_Recommended_Scripts
* and http://www.unicode.org/reports/tr31/#Aspirational_Use_Scripts
* This includes codepoints that are not defined as Unicode
* characters
*
* Illegal combinations of scripts (@see illegalScriptCombo)
*
* Numbers from more than one different numbering system
*
* Sequences of the same non-spacing mark
*
* Both simplified-only and traditional-only Chinese characters
* XXX this test was disabled by bug 857481
*/
bool isLabelSafe(const nsAString &label);
/**
* Determine whether a combination of scripts in a single label is
* permitted according to the algorithm defined in UTR 39 and the
* profile selected in mRestrictionProfile.
*
* For the "Highly restrictive" profile, all characters in each
* identifier must be from a single script, or from the combinations:
* Latin + Han + Hiragana + Katakana;
* Latin + Han + Bopomofo; or
* Latin + Han + Hangul
*
* For the "Moderately restrictive" profile, Latin is also allowed
* with other scripts except Cyrillic and Greek
*/
bool illegalScriptCombo(int32_t script, int32_t& savedScript);

/**
* Flag set by the pref network.IDN_show_punycode. When it is true,
* IDNs containing non-ASCII characters are always displayed to the
* user in punycode
*/
bool mShowPunycode;
/**
* Restriction-level Detection profiles defined in UTR 39
* http://www.unicode.org/reports/tr39/#Restriction_Level_Detection,
* and selected by the pref network.IDN.restriction_profile
*/
enum restrictionProfile {
eASCIIOnlyProfile,
eHighlyRestrictiveProfile,
eModeratelyRestrictiveProfile
};
restrictionProfile mRestrictionProfile;
